Latest Patents
Richlie's latest patents include a "Vehicle Seating System" and a "System and Method for Controlling Adjustment of Vehicle Seats." The Vehicle Seating System patent describes a method for controlling the movement of a seat in a vehicle, which includes a lower seat assembly and an upper seat assembly that can be adjusted relative to one another. An actuator assembly is pivotally attached between these assemblies, allowing for selective adjustments between upright and folded positions. The control unit plays a crucial role in actuating the motor and actuator assembly to manage the seat's movement based on sensor feedback.
The second patent, the "System and Method for Controlling Adjustment of Vehicle Seats," outlines a system where first and second seating modules can move between upright and folded positions. This system is designed to respond to activation elements, with a control unit that generates signals to manage the movement of the seating modules. Notably, the control unit ensures that the second seating module does not move until the first module has been adjusted, enhancing safety and functionality.
